New Audi A8 reveal

* New car to be unveiled * Premier at art and design event * Just teaser pics so far...

Author Avatar
What Car? Staff
19 November 2009

New Audi A8 reveal

The new Audi A8 will be revealed on November 30 in Miami.

The covers will come off the new Mercedes-Benz S-Class rival at a temporary 'museum structure' on the eve of the Design Miami fair..

Pictures and more details of the new flagship Audi will be released during the event.